Какова альтернатива видимого true / false для представлений в прикосновении какао? - PullRequest
0 голосов
/ 24 ноября 2010

Я настраиваю ячейку просмотра таблицы, что мне до сих пор очень сложно.

После прочтения руководства Apple я настраиваю свои ячейки, загружая их из файла пера и управляя ими программно.

поэтому вместо создания двух разных типов nib-файлов (ячеек таблицы) один с текстовым полем, а другой с видом сборщика.

Я делаю гибридную клетку. в моем nib-файле я добавляю UILabel, UItextField, UIPickerView.

Теперь о cellForRowAtIndexPath для таблицы (после того, как я связал каждую ячейку с нибфилем) Я хочу иметь возможность программно использовать pickerView ИЛИ текстовое поле. Теперь нет свойства visible для использования, чтобы показать одно и скрыть другое.

Итак, каков наилучший подход здесь. Я немного новичок в какао, и рамки не дают мне много вариантов. Так, например, если indexpath равен 0,1, я хочу, чтобы это был pickerViewCell. и если indexPath равен 0,2, я хочу, чтобы это было textfieldCell.

Так, если indexpath равен 0,1? что я должен делать? я должен избавиться от текстового поля? изменить его координаты куда-нибудь, что никогда не будет видимым? отключить это? что? и если мой подход неправильный и не рекомендуется, каков рекомендуемый путь? я должен вернуться и удалить pickerView из пера, и создать другой файл пера только с меткой и видом пикара? и при загрузке решить, какой из них загрузить? Спасибо

1 Ответ

0 голосов
/ 24 ноября 2010

Видимость видимости контролируется свойством hidden (то есть противоположностью видимому) - вы можете использовать его в вашем случае

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...